Nationstar Mortgage faced significant challenges during a period of rapid growth in 2012 and 2013. The employee population tripled, causing desktop logons to slow to as long as three minutes and desktops to sometimes freeze, making it impossible to work. A complex Excel query by one user could lock up an entire server, leading to trouble tickets soaring to 300 a day. The company was adding 10 servers a week, but it wasn't enough to keep up with the demand. Profile corruption, performance problems, and server crashes were common issues, and the IT team was constantly in firefighting mode.

Based in Lewisville, Texas, Nationstar Mortgage offers servicing, origination, and real estate services to financial institutions and consumers. As one of the nation’s largest mortgage servicers, its clients include national and regional banks, government organizations, securitization trusts, private investment funds, and other owners of residential mortgage loans and securities. Nationstar maintains a virtual desktop environment using Citrix XenApp, and during a period of significant growth, the employee population tripled, leading to various IT challenges.

To address these challenges, Nationstar Mortgage implemented AppSense DesktopNow, which includes Performance Manager and Environment Manager. The deployment took only two months and started with a 500-seat proof of concept that showed immediate positive results. AppSense professional services were knowledgeable and accommodated Nationstar's use cases, quickly providing a solution. Performance Manager ensured that users shared system resources equally, decreased memory per session, and enabled Nationstar to boost user density per host. Environment Manager eliminated Terminal Services roaming profiles and custom login scripts, moving logon scripts and group policy objects (GPOs) to AppSense. This significantly improved logon times and reduced the number of trouble tickets.

Nationstar now supports 7,500 users with DesktopNow, regaining control of its user environment and allowing IT to evaluate new products and improve the user experience.

Reduced trouble tickets from 300 per day to less than 10 on average.
Decreased logon times from as long as three minutes to between 14 and 20 seconds.
Increased server density by 10 percent.
